This tutorial provides an overview of the Ross Carbonite Black video production switcher, which has two Mixed Effects (ME) capabilities. The switcher allows for effects such as chroma key, split screens, and picture-in-picture. The top ME is typically used for setting up effects, while the bottom ME (ME2) is used for the majority of the work. The tutorial also covers basic button functions and demonstrates switching between camera and Mac inputs on the program and preview screens.
